The name “King Schools’ is at the top of the list for nearly every student pilot looking for guidance on the recreational or vocational paths...

King’s Barry Knutilla provides an update on what we can expect next. The National Association of Flight Instructors is proposing to hold a major meeting of flight instructors in 2023 and broadening their reach after selecting new leadership last year. Virtual Fly shows off a number of next generation flight sims for both recreational and professional student training programs... including a number of type specific platforms. A somewhat muted ‘Meet The Boss’ session was held in EAA’s Theater in The woods once again with Acting FAA Administrator Billy Nolen... and while a lot of issues were addressed... few concrete answers were provided. The historic D-Day Squadron Has Announced A European Tour In 2024.... And We’re Kinda Hoping We Get To Go Along... and in our next segment with Jack Pelton, we continue our chat about the problems sport and general aviation still faces... and what we might do about it all. All this -- and MORE in today's episode of Airborne!!!
